

Unitrends and IBM Storage Protect both compete in the backup and disaster recovery space. Unitrends appears to have the upper hand with its ease of setup and versatile recovery features, while IBM excels in scalability and support for large databases.
Features: Unitrends is renowned for its compatibility with both virtual and physical environments, ease of setup, and comprehensive reporting. It supports instant VM recovery directly from the appliance, enhancing its usability. IBM Storage Protect provides robust scalability with features like deduplication and compression, along with strong support for databases such as DV2, Oracle, and Informix. It also offers incremental backups and an enterprise-wide architecture suited for complex environments.
Room for Improvement: Unitrends could improve its technical support and streamline the interface to improve user experiences during challenging situations. It could benefit from enhanced cloud integration and lower support costs. IBM Storage Protect requires better user-friendliness and licensing simplification. Enhancements in its cloud integration and broader database and virtualization platform support are needed to maintain competitiveness.
Ease of Deployment and Customer Service: Unitrends benefits from straightforward deployment due to its appliance-based solution, easing the setup process significantly. However, it has mixed reviews for customer service. IBM Storage Protect provides a robust support network suitable for on-premises and cloud environments. However, handling of complex configurations can be inconsistent, which might give Unitrends an edge in quicker issue resolution at times.
Pricing and ROI: Unitrends offers hardware-inclusive licensing which could be appealing, but high support costs can make it expensive. It presents better return on investment in larger deployments. IBM Storage Protect is perceived as high-priced, especially for enterprises, and its complicated licensing can reduce cost-effectiveness. The relationship between pricing and organizational needs should be scrutinized for both products.

IBM Storage Protect offers data protection and management to secure critical business information efficiently. It's designed to be a scalable and flexible solution for data backup, recovery, and archive needs in complex IT environments.
IBM Storage Protect delivers comprehensive data protection by integrating backup, recovery, and archiving functionalities. It supports a range of workloads and infrastructures, from on-premises to cloud environments, facilitating efficient data management. Its platform provides seamless scalability to meet evolving business needs, underpinned by reliable security measures. Organizations leverage its capabilities to ensure business continuity and minimize data loss risks, making it vital in a data-driven world.

Unitrends offers cloud replication, remote management, and instant recovery, making it highly versatile for backup needs across physical and virtual nodes. Its seamless functionality and robust support ensure enhanced operational efficiency.
Unitrends is known for its ability to integrate with physical and virtual environments, ideal for backing up Azure VMs, local systems, and diverse operating systems. Users employ Unitrends for daily backups, disaster recovery, and file recovery tasks, protecting servers, VMware, Hyper-V clusters, and legacy systems. Real-time synchronization and monitoring are key to its efficiency, although some areas like interface and support structure require refinement. Pricing and stability concerns, as well as SQL backup sensitivity, suggest room for improvement. Users often encounter issues with billing, renewals, and dual VPN support, seeking more scalable and affordable options.
